Daniel Michael Named Chief of Enforcement Division’s Complex Financial Instruments Unit — SEC Press Release

By Securities Docket on December 7, 2017, 6:35 pm

The Securities and Exchange Commission today announced that Daniel Michael has been named chief of the Enforcement Division’s Complex Financial Instruments Unit.

In his new role, Mr. Michael will lead a specialized unit of attorneys and industry experts who are located in offices across the country and investigate potential misconduct related to complex financial products and practices involving sophisticated market participants.
